Top 5 Word Puzzle Games in Belgium Q2 2024

In the second quarter of 2024, the top 5 word puzzle games on a unified platform in Belgium showed varied performance metrics. Here’s a closer look at their downloads, revenue, and weekly active users trends.

Zen Word® - Relax Puzzle Game experienced a remarkable growth in revenue, starting from $20 in the first week of April and peaking at $375K in the week of June 10. Downloads also surged significantly, reaching a peak of approximately 17.5K in the week of April 29, before gradually declining to around 4.8K by the end of June. Weekly active users mirrored this trend, peaking at about 25.9K in mid-June and settling at 23.7K by the end of the quarter.

Words of Wonders: Crossword generated a steady revenue, fluctuating between $488 and $936 throughout the quarter. Download numbers showed a declining trend, starting at 7.4K in early April and dropping to 3.6K by the end of June. The game maintained a consistent weekly active user base, averaging around 27K throughout the quarter.

Cryptogram: Word Brain Puzzle had a stable revenue stream, ranging from $112 to $190 across the quarter. Downloads saw a peak of 6.9K in mid-April but fluctuated before reaching 4K in the final week of June. The game’s weekly active users remained relatively steady, fluctuating between 16.8K and 23.6K, with a noticeable increase towards the end of June.

Associations: Word Puzzle Game experienced a modest revenue, peaking at $91 in early April and ending at $43 in late June. Downloads decreased over the quarter, starting at 3.9K and dropping to 1.2K. The weekly active users fluctuated slightly but remained around 10K, peaking at 12.2K in early April.

Wordscapes maintained a steady revenue, ranging between $173 and $334 throughout the quarter. Downloads saw a downward trend, beginning at 2.7K in early April and reducing to 947 by the end of June. Weekly active users showed a slight decline from 19.4K to 15.5K, with occasional peaks and troughs.
